Output 75858530ae0d9f34fc41908e4a8bec9d2335989b2e8c8d1d06898f2a85832fc9:0

value
1024594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9399c7a9ca04c1d9241e2eda07ffeb8b0901653 OP_EQUAL
address
3NxCP94UxhFjKM6oEPmip9eQ3F26KVYrhY
transaction
75858530ae0d9f34fc41908e4a8bec9d2335989b2e8c8d1d06898f2a85832fc9
spent
true